Bucks County Stone & Clapboard Colonial A gracious Bucks County Colonial is serenely poised on three scenic acres along a quiet cul- de- sac road in Tewksbury Township. Its handsome stone and clapboard exterior is enhanced by a stately columned entry, covered bluestone front porch, paver walkways and a long drive marked by lighted stone pillars. Rolling acreage takes in majestic views of professional landscaping, mature trees and fieldstone walls. The open floor plan of over 4,300 square feet features five bedrooms, three full baths and two powder rooms. Custom built by Bocina in 1997, the detailed interior contains many desirable features such as high ceilings, oak hardwood flooring, two fireplaces and a generously-dimensioned floor plan of eleven rooms. The elegant point of entry is a two-story foyer featuring a curved staircase with railed gallery overlook, shimmering chandelier and Palladian window. A welcoming focal point in the living room is a stone hearth fireplace encased by a white painted wood mantle. The inverted dome ceiling medallion adds overhead interest in the dining room, which is fitted with chair railing and crown molding. Oak hardwood flooring and a ceiling fan are complimentary features in the home office. In the welcoming gourmet kitchen, a gleaming granite topped center island and breakfast bar, pickled wood cabinetry, ceramic tile backsplash, Corian counters, upper-end appliances from GE Profile and mural-painted walls are among the outstanding amenities and a sunny breakfast area with French doors opens to a spacious deck. Nearby, a step-down great room is appointed with beamed cathedral ceiling, a floor-to-ceiling stone fireplace with gas insert, sliding glass doors to the deck and a balcony overlook from the upper hallway. Also on the main floor are two powder rooms, a laundry room and mud room. Upstairs, the spacious master bedroom with tray ceiling and dual walk-in closets connects to an opulent master bath designed with a jetted tub set under a picture window, double sink vanities, a glass door shower and private commode. Three additional bedrooms share another full bath on this level. A secondary staircase with elevator lift on the first floor leads to the guest bedroom suite with sitting room and full tile bath. Further amenities in this graceful Colonial include an attached three-car garage with automatic openers, a side covered porch entrance to the mud room, and a spacious deck featuring a pergola-topped hot tub. Home systems call for multiple zones of hot air heating, central air conditioning, central vacuum, security system, well water and private septic. Tewksbury Township in Hunterdon County offers a small-town lifestyle thats close to a network of highways for easy access to Manhattan or local business campuses. The entire area has a longstanding history dating back to the pre-Revolutionary War era, and retains much of its original character. Fine old homes, equestrian estates and working farms dot the townships picturesque open landscape of rolling hills and fields.
